Ah, the "new this week" makes this interesting and different from what
we have. I would definitely like to see both new bugs & patches.
I can imagine some more features:
- resolved items this week (good for morale, assuming it's a number > 0)
- active items (items that had at least one comment added or other
status change)
- comatose items (items with exceptionally long inactivity)
- unassigned items
- new unassigned items with no comments added (those are the ones that
need triage most dearly)
